首页 > TAG信息列表 > OneToOne
@OneToOne 匹配不到时
@OneToOne @JoinColumn(name = "message_fileinfo_id",referencedColumnName = "id",insertable = false,updatable = false) @NotFound(action = NotFoundAction.IGNORE) @OneToOne匹配时,若message_fileinfo_id匹配不到id,则会报错,此时加上@NotFound(action = NotFounDjango笔记七之ManyToMany和OneToOne介绍
ManyToMany 是一种多对多的关系,在用途和使用方法上和外键 ForeignKey 类似。 以下是本篇笔记的目录: ManyToMany 的介绍 through 参数 through_fields 参数 ManyToMany关系数据的增删改查 OneToOne介绍 1、ManyToMany 的介绍 假设有两个 model,Person 和 Group,这两个model之间是多@OneToOne
@Entity @Getter @Setter @Table(name="tb_participant") public class ParticipantEntity extends MappingEntity implements Serializable { private static final long serialVersionUID = 276431614574466988L; @Id @GeneratedValue(strategy = Ge孙卫琴的《精通JPA与Hibernate》的读书笔记:用@OneToOne注解映射一对一关联
在以下图中,ADDRESSES表的ID字段既是主键,同时作为外键参照CUSTOMERS表的主键,也就是说,ADDRESSES表与CUSTOMERS表共享主键。 在Customer类中,也是用@OneToOne注解来映射homeAddress属性: @OneToOne( cascade=CascadeType.ALL, mappedBy="customer" ) private Address hom@ManyToOne @OneToOne返回数据中"$ref"问题,其实是fastjson问题
返回数据为 这样前端就无法获取正确数据(至少是不改变代码,不增加代码量的情况下) 所以还是改返回值比较好 根据查阅 https://blog.csdn.net/qq_38487524/article/details/82784780 结合调试,这个博主说的没问题 所以这就是fastjson的转换问题了 另外参考这位博主的办法,由于找不到全Hibernate @OneToOne懒加载实现解决方案
在hibernate注解(三)中,我提高过一对一(@OneToOne)懒加载失效的问题。虽然给出了解决方法,但并没有给出完整的解决方案。今天我专门针对该问题进行讨论。至于懒加载失效的原因,在之前的文章中已经我已经叙述过了,就不再重复了,不明白的可以去看看。 一、测试环境 数据库:myqsl 代码:主:Student